International Workshop on Gender and Education

The third workshop on Gender and Education, jointly organised by Collegio Carlo Alberto, INVALSI, University of Torino, and University of Trento. The workshop will be held in presence at the Collegio Carlo Alberto in Torino on September 30 and October 1, 2022.

The keynote speakers are: Francesca Borgonovi (OECD, UCL) and Caterina Calsamiglia (Barcelona IPEG).
